Abstract

The corrosion inhibition behaviour of Neem (Azadirachta indica) mature leaves extract as a green inhibitor of zinc corrosion in hydrochloric acid (HCl) solutions has been studied using gravimetric and thermometric techniques for experiments conducted at 30°C and 60°C. The results revealed that different concentrations of the Azadirachta indica (AZI) extract inhibit zinc corrosion and that inhibition efficiency of the extract varies with concentration and temperature. For extract concentrations studied and ranging from 9.09–23.08mg/L, the maximum inhibition efficiency was 78.33% and 68.95% both at 23.08mg/L AZI at 30°C and 60°C, respectively in 2.0N HCl.
